From this year on, ESWC will be under the umbrella of SWSA, the Semantic Web Science Association, to secure financial sustainability for the upcoming years after its previous supporting organisation STI was dissolved in 2023. Basics about the transition are given by Elena Simperl, president of SWSA.

Our meetup was well-attended with two interesting talks:
📋 Sarah Julia Kriesch presented "Docker vs Podman" - a beginner-friendly introduction to container basics and key differences between these tools.
🔧 Philip Laine showcased "Spegel", an OCI Registry Mirror that leverages torrent technology for efficient container image distribution - saving traffic costs and safeguarding against registry outages.

Next stop in our NLP timeline is 2013, the introduction of low dimensional dense word vectors - so-called "word embeddings" - based on distributed semantics, as e.g. word2vec by Mikolov et al. from Google, which enabled representation learning on text.
T. Mikolov et al. (2013). Efficient Estimation of Word Representations in Vector Space.

Last leg on our brief history of NLP (so far) is the advent of large language models with GPT-3 in 2020 and the introduction of learning from the prompt (aka few-shot learning).
T. B. Brown et al. (2020). Language models are few-shot learners. NIPS'20
